Common Fender Repair Problems
Fenders, the curved panels that cover your car’s wheels, are vulnerable to various types of damage. Understanding these common issues is the first step in knowing what kind of fender repair Magnolia-Riverside you might need. Here’s a breakdown:
- Dents: These can range from small dings to significant indentations. Dents can be caused by impacts from other vehicles, objects, or even hail.
- Scratches: Scratches are a common occurrence, often resulting from close encounters with other cars, bushes, or other road hazards. While seemingly minor, scratches can expose the underlying metal to rust.
- Cracks: Cracks in the fender, particularly around the wheel wells or along the edges, can be caused by impacts or, in some cases, the stress of repeated bumps on the road.
- Rust: Rust is a major concern, especially in areas with frequent rain or snow. If the paint is chipped or scratched, allowing moisture to reach the metal, rust will inevitably develop. Left untreated, rust can weaken the fender and spread.
- Holes: Impact damage, or advanced rust, can sometimes lead to holes in the fender. These require more extensive repair work.
- Misalignment: Sometimes, the fender can become misaligned after an impact. This can cause the door to not open or close correctly, or the lines of the car to not match.

How long will a typical fender repair take?
The time required for fender repair Magnolia-Riverside varies depending on the extent of the damage. Minor dents and scratches can often be repaired in a day or two. More extensive repairs, such as those involving significant structural damage, may take longer. Your auto body shop will provide an estimated timeframe during the assessment process. -
Does my insurance cover fender repair?
Whether your insurance covers fender repair Magnolia-Riverside depends on your insurance policy and the cause of the damage. If the damage was caused by a covered event, such as a collision, your insurance may cover the cost of the repair, minus your deductible. It is best to contact your insurance company to clarify your coverage. -
